首页 > 其他
hdu 4496 D-City(并查集)
题目链接:hdu 4496 D-City 题目大意:给出一张图,按照给定边的顺序逐个删除,问没删除一条之后的联通块数量。 解题思路:逆向并查集求联通分量,假设一开始各个城市都不连通,然后从最后一条边开始添加,如果新添加的边联通了两个联通块,那么联通分量就要减1,最后在正序输出即可。 #include #include const int N = 10005; c...
分类:其他   时间:2014-04-26 01:18:05    收藏:0  评论:0  赞:0  阅读:496
数据结构----Trie 树
1. 简述 Trie 树是一种高效的字符串查找的数据结构。可用于搜索引擎中词频统计,自动补齐等。 在一个Trie 树中插入、查找某个单词的时间复杂度是 O(len), len是单词的长度。 如果采用平衡二叉树来存储的话,时间复杂度是 O(lgN), N为树中单词的总数。 此外,Trie 树还特别擅长 前缀搜索,比方说现在输入法中的自动补齐,输入某个单词的前缀,abs, 立刻弹出 ...
分类:其他   时间:2014-04-26 00:41:51    收藏:0  评论:0  赞:0  阅读:575
一生中经历了1009次失败。但他却说:一次成功就够了
有一个人,一生中经历了1009次失败。但他却说:“一次成功就够了。”   5岁时,他的父亲突然病逝,没有留下任何财产。母亲外出做工。年幼的他在家照顾弟妹,并学会自己做饭。 12岁时,母亲改嫁,继父对他十分严厉,常在母亲外出时痛打他。 14岁时,他辍学离校,开始了流浪生活。 16岁时,他谎报年龄参加了远征军。因航行途中晕船厉害,被提前遣送回乡。 18岁时,他娶了个...
分类:其他   时间:2014-04-26 02:38:58    收藏:0  评论:0  赞:0  阅读:520
hdu1384 poj1202 Intervals --- 差分约束
差分约束系统 差分约束系统的应用难点在于将实际问题转换为差分约束系统。 简单来说,要构造出一系列满足题意的不等式 形如 Si-Sj 对于每一个这样的不等式,构造有向边 w(j->i)=Ck。 为保证图的连通,我们引入附加结点Vs。初始化w(s->i)=0,d[Vs]=0 接下来就是求解源点到其他点的单源最短路径。 由于差分约束系统中通常含负值,所以我们一般用spfa或者...
分类:其他   时间:2014-04-26 03:10:15    收藏:0  评论:0  赞:0  阅读:773
comboBox控件获取选中文本值
做B/S开发很少使用winform,最近用了一次dataGridView控件发现与Asp.Net上的GridView有很大不同。      1、dataGridView获取选中项的文本值使用comboBox1.SelectedItem.ToString()获取的是空值 可以用comboBox1.Text获取文本值      2、获取ID值任然是comboBox1.SelectedValue ...
分类:其他   时间:2014-04-26 02:04:21    收藏:0  评论:0  赞:0  阅读:725
camShift实现目标跟踪
过程:     反向投影,meanShift算法,camShift算法。 简要概述:     反向投影:利用直方图,求输入图中对应像素在目标图中的概率(出现次数频率),作为输出图对应像素的值。     meanShift算法:均值漂移,知道收敛到设定值。     camShift算法:调用meanShift,实现自适应大小的目标跟踪。 //对运动物体的跟踪: //如果背景固定,...
分类:其他   时间:2014-04-26 03:41:38    收藏:0  评论:0  赞:0  阅读:493
Fckeditor使用方法
测试Fckeditor版本为:2.6.3 JS代码中各个参数具体作用 var oFCKeditor = new FCKeditor( 'content' ) ;//此参数会作为提交表单时的参数名 oFCKeditor.BasePath = "/fckeditor/" ;//一定要指定editor文件夹所在的路径,并且要以'/'结尾 oFCKeditor.Height = 300...
分类:其他   时间:2014-04-26 01:34:33    收藏:0  评论:0  赞:0  阅读:515
hdu 4499 Cannon(暴力)
题目链接:hdu 4499 Cannon 题目大意:给出一个n*m的棋盘,上面已经存在了k个棋子,给出棋子的位置,然后求可以在这样的棋盘上放多少个炮,要求后放置上去的炮相互之间不能攻击。 解题思路:枚举行放的情况,用二进制数表示,每次放之前判断是否能放下(会不会和已经存在的棋子冲突),放下后判断会不会互相攻击的炮,只需要对每个新添加的炮考虑左边以及上边就可以了。 #i...
分类:其他   时间:2014-04-26 01:14:49    收藏:0  评论:0  赞:0  阅读:444
使用maven profile实现多环境可移植构建
在开发过程中,我们的软件会面对不同的运行环境,比如开发环境、测试环境、生产环境,而我们的软件在不同的环境中,有的配置可能会不一样,比如数据源配置、日志文件配置、以及一些软件运行过程中的基本配置,那每次我们将软件部署到不同的环境时,都需要修改相应的配置文件,这样来回修改,是个很麻烦的事情。有没有一种方法能够让我们不用修改配置就能发布到不同的环境中呢?当然有,这就是接下来要做的事。...
分类:其他   时间:2014-04-26 03:03:41    收藏:0  评论:0  赞:0  阅读:486
hdu 4597 Play Game(记忆化搜索)
题目链接:hdu 4597 Play Game 题目大意:给出两堆牌,只能从最上和最下取,然后两个人轮流取,都按照自己最优的策略,问说第一个人对多的分值。 解题思路:记忆化搜索,状态出来就非常水,dp[fl][fr][sl][sr][flag],表示第一堆牌上边取到fl,下面取到fr,同样sl,sr为第二堆牌,flag为第几个人在取。如果是第一个人,dp既要尽量大,如果是第二个...
分类:其他   时间:2014-04-26 01:49:24    收藏:0  评论:0  赞:0  阅读:546
hdu 1535 Invitation Cards
http://acm.hdu.edu.cn/showproblem.php?pid=1535这道题两遍spfa,第一遍sfpa之后,重新建图,所有的边逆向建边,再一次spfa就可以了。 1 #include 2 #include 3 #include 4 #include 5 #includ...
分类:其他   时间:2014-04-25 23:42:24    收藏:0  评论:0  赞:0  阅读:857
HDU 1004 Let the Balloon Rise
http://acm.hdu.edu.cn/showproblem.php?pid=1004题意:有n个气球,找出出现次数最多的颜色。题解:练习map……其实用strcmp()也可以。 1 #include 2 #include 3 #include 4 #include 5 #includ...
分类:其他   时间:2014-04-25 23:48:59    收藏:0  评论:0  赞:0  阅读:819
Poj 3041 Asteroids
http://poj.org/problem?id=3041题意:在N*N的网格中有K颗小行星。小行星i的位置是(Ri,Ci)。用一个武器发射光束,可以把一行或者一列的小行星消除。要摧毁所有小行星,至少要用多少束光束。题解:二分图匹配的模型之一。以横坐标和纵坐标做匹配。其实这是最小顶点覆盖问题,但在...
分类:其他   时间:2014-04-25 23:50:35    收藏:0  评论:0  赞:0  阅读:953
菜鸟学EJB(二)——在同一个SessionBean中使用@Remote和@Local
不废话,直接进入正题: 在Jboss4及以前的版本中,如下代码可以成功部署:package com.tjb.ejb;import javax.ejb.Local;import javax.ejb.Remote;import javax.ejb.Stateless;@Stateless@Remot.....
分类:其他   时间:2014-04-25 23:53:55    收藏:0  评论:0  赞:0  阅读:884
第十四讲 多维数组学习
多维数组的汇编跟一维的类似,不过要细心看才能找出规律。还是看代码 int a[3][3]; a[0][0]=0; a[0][1]=0; a[0][1]=0; a[1][0]=1; a[1][1]=1; a[1][2]=1; a[2][0]=2; a[2][1]=2; a[2][2]=2;画图出来是如...
分类:其他   时间:2014-04-25 23:55:35    收藏:0  评论:0  赞:0  阅读:859
golang之交叉编译设置
俺的环境,os x,目的,生成64位linux的elf文件直接下载osx的包就可以,不需要特意去下载源码包,我的go目录是~/tools/golang/gocd ~/tools/golang/go/srcCGO_ENABLED=0 GOOS=linux GOARCH=amd64 ./make.bas...
分类:其他   时间:2014-04-25 23:58:49    收藏:0  评论:0  赞:0  阅读:871
VISUAL STUDIO 2012下的OPENCV 2.4.7安装过程
邮箱已经收到了Visual Studio 2013的升级通知,但是很多软件如OpenCV、Qt等都只有VS2012的预编译库,还是懒得升级了(除非VS支持C++11了)。网上搜了一些VS2012(或VS2010)安装OpenCV的教程,抄来抄去很不规范……还是直接参考官方的安装过程靠谱,你可以把本文...
分类:其他   时间:2014-04-26 00:02:10    收藏:0  评论:0  赞:0  阅读:717
OC基础第三讲
继承、初始化方法继承1.基本概念继承的上层—父类, 继承的下层—子类, 子类继承父类全部的特征和行为。根类(NSObject): 没有父类的类继承是单向的,不能相互继承,且OC中只允许单继承继承具有传递性2.Supersuper是编译器指令,并非对象,而self是指针(即对象)作用:调用从父类继承的...
分类:其他   时间:2014-04-26 00:03:51    收藏:0  评论:0  赞:0  阅读:455
日期计算
日期计算时间限制:3000ms | 内存限制:65535KB难度:1描述如题,输入一个日期,格式如:2010 10 24 ,判断这一天是这一年中的第几天。输入第一行输入一个数N(002.#include03.#include04.#include05.#include06.#include07.us...
分类:其他   时间:2014-04-26 00:05:31    收藏:0  评论:0  赞:0  阅读:563
Just for Today
Just for today I will try to live through this day only and not tackle my whole life problem at once.I can do something for twelve hours that would ap...
分类:其他   时间:2014-04-26 00:07:07    收藏:0  评论:0  赞:0  阅读:450
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!